Mysore/Mysuru: The Mysuru City Corporation has implemented odd-even rules in all wholesale markets in the city, under which traders will sell fruits, vegetables and other essentials on alternate days. The timing has been fixed from 6 am to 5 pm.  The odd-even rule has been passed on Apr. 23 (yesterday) and will be in force…

Bengaluru: Urban Development Minister Byrathi Basavaraj said that restoration of 129-year-old Lansdowne Building and 137-year-old Devaraja Market in Mysuru will be taken up only after the receipt of report from the Special Heritage Committee as well as final orders of Karnataka High Court. He was answering to questions raised by Chamaraja MLA L.Nagendra on whether…
